How to find divorce records - Divorce records are highly important when research family history: From 11 January 1858, the new London-based Court for Divorce and Matrimonial Causes heard all divorce and matrimonial cases.In 1873 it was reformed into the Probate, Divorce and Admiralty Division of the Supreme Court of Judicature.The Divorce Registry is now part …

They are the managing NY state agency for vital records which include marriage and divorce records and birth and death … The California Department of Public Health – Vital Records (CDPH-VR) maintains divorce records for only 1962 through June 1984. These records consist only of the face sheet of the divorce action – not the actual divorce decree. CDPH-VR is only able to provide you with a Certificate of Record, which includes the names of the parties, filing ... The Tennessee Office of Vital Statistics has a statewide register of divorces after 1 January 1949 and can verify the date and county of a divorce or annulment. You can get application forms (and instructions) for divorce certificates from the Office of Vital Statistics web site: Office of Vital Records - Tennessee Department of Health.If you find yourself in an unhappy or unhealthy marriage, a divorce can dissolve your legal union and give you a fresh start. The Office of Vital Records can search for an event, if you submit a request containing the full name(s) of the person whose record you are searching for, the approximate date of the event and the city and/or county where you believe the … To obtain a Nebraska divorce certificate, submit a record request to the Department of Health and Human Services. The Vital Records Office has records of all divorces in the state since 1909. For records prior to this date, contact the Clerk of the District Court where the divorce judgment was issued.
